Based on the amended act, a 9% VAT rate is declared for restaurant and catering services, as well as hotel accommodation activities. Following the amendments made to the Fiscal Code by GEO 16/2022, the VAT rate will be increased from 5% to 9%. The change became effective on January 1, 2023, for the following…
